Control of electron wave-packets in high-order harmonic generation by ultrashort light pulses

C Vozzi;L Poletto;
2006

Abstract

In this work we show that the use of light pulses with stabilized carrier-envelope phase allows one to control the attosecond electron wave-packets generated by the interaction between the high-peak-power light pulse and atoms. When the duration of the driving field is shorter than similar to 5 fs, such control offers the possibility to generate a broad continuum in the cutoff spectral region of the generated harmonic spectrum, clear signature of the confinement of the harmonic emission to a single attosecond burst. Moreover we will analyze the effects of phase-stabilization in the case of multiple-cycle driving pulses
